�... <br />ACTIVE COMMUNITIES MINI-GRANT APPLICATION FORM <br />Applicant Information: <br />Organization: City of Pequot Lakes Minnesota <br />Contact Person: Nancy Adams, Mayor <br />Mailing Address: 4638 County Road 11, Pequot Lakes, MN 56472 <br />Telephone: 218-568-5222 <br />Email: ma,�(�a�peauotlakes-mn.� <br />Fax: 218-568-5860 <br />Proposed Action Plan: <br />Goals & objectives: Pequot Lakes has a wonderful park system. In conjunction with the <br />numerous initiatives ongoing in the area, we want to make these <br />parks more bicycle-friendly. <br />`.• Why needed: As the parks have been studied, bike racks have been noticeably missing or <br />in short supply. Racks would make biking into town and/or visiting the <br />parks a much more attractive activity. <br />Population impacted: Pequot Lakes is a community of approximately 2,000 residents. <br />For 2010, there were 31,977 registered visitors at the Chamber's <br />Trailside Center. We certainly acknowledge that not all of these <br />people will avail themselves of the bike racks, but we do know that <br />a lot of these people used the Paul Bunyan Trail and would have <br />like to have a safe spot for their bikes. <br />Sustained policy, system &/or environmental change resulting from the project: <br />Having bicycle racks available throughout the parks encourages bike riding <br />into and within the community. People understand that they have a secure <br />place to lock their bikes and walk around the community or play at the parks. <br />In the neighborhood parks, it encourages parents to ride their with their <br />children (rather than come by car). <br />How to know the project is successful: The bike racks will be installed permanently in <br />the parks and will be used by the many people <br />who need to lock their bicycles. <br />� <br />
